The Transformation of Fly Fishing Equipment: From Tradition to Innovation

Fly fishing—an art that dates back centuries—has historically relied on handcrafted rods, natural materials, and traditional techniques. However, recent decades have ushered in a surge of technological advancements that have significantly elevated both the performance and sustainability of the sport.

Modern materials such as carbon fibre rods, synthetic fibres for lines, and environmentally friendly tackle have revolutionized the angler’s experience. For example, while bamboo rods commanded the market in the past, composite materials now offer greater durability, lighter weight, and improved casting precision.
